category image
678 results
Ota Market

Ota Market

Marie Guirao

The Ota Market (Ota Ichiba in Japanese) happily welcomes visitors to its fish, food and flower auctions.

Tokyo 1
Machida Sakura Festival 2026

Machida Sakura Festival 2026

Mar 28th - Mar 29th

The Machida Sakura Festival is a multi-venue event which celebrates the best of cherry blossom season in the area.

Tokyo
OK Supermarket

OK Supermarket

Shehzad Lokhandwalla

A typical Japanese supermarket can be really entertaining, especially if you haven't seen anything like it before. Japanese..

Tokyo
Akihabara UDX Illumination 2026

Akihabara UDX Illumination 2026

Mid Nov - Late Dec

From early November until late March, Tokyo's Akihabara UDX will host an illumination event under the theme "Happy Rainbow UDX..

Tokyo Free Entry